Polybase data loading

The fastest and most scalable way to load data is through PolyBase.This eliminates the need to retrieve the external data separately and loading it into the SQL Data Warehouse for further analysis.
Practical Tips on Polybase data load to Azure Synapse
test_2019_02_01.
: Copying data from/to Azure Cosmos DB: when RU is under .In this tutorial, Sahaj Saini walks you through configuring and executing PolyBase to load data from Azure storage to Azure SQL Data Warehouse.
Using PolyBase to Load Data to a Dedicated SQL Pool Table
1) If there is incremental growth of data then how will the PolyBase work. Por qué usar PolyBase. This technology was introduced by Microsoft in 2012 to allow a relational database such . Skip to main content. Try for free Contact sales.In this Microsoft Azure Step-by-Step Tutorial I'm showing how to use PolyBase external tables to load data from Azure Data Lake Storage Gen1 & Gen2 into Azur. Allow external network access to access publicly . CREATE EXTERNAL TABLE (CET): Creates a table where the data stays in its original location outside of . First test, loading the DataBricks DataFrame to Azure SQL DW directly without using PolyBase and Blob Storage, simply via JDBC connection. SQL Server 2022 (16. Run sp_configure with 'hadoop connectivity' set to an Azure Blob Storage provider.
What Is Polybase In Azure
See examples of queries using the PolyBase feature of SQL Server, including SELECT, JOIN external . You can use this information to correctly define external tables with the CREATE EXTERNAL TABLE Transact-SQL command. Other alternatives include relieving Polybase of the unzip work as part of your upload or staging process.
-- Values map to various external data sources.
Get started with PolyBase in SQL Server 2022
)
azure-docs/articles/synapse-analytics/sql/load-data-overview
We share a client example as well.Azure SQL Data Warehouse: DW400.You can also utilize the SQL Server (sqlserver://) connector to access Azure SQL Database. By Default, the Hadoop connectivity is set to 7. Part 1 – Secured Storage Account. You switched accounts on another tab or window. Let’s have a look at the use cases for PolyBase: Query data stored in Hadoop, Azure Blob Storage or Azure Data Lake Store from Azure SQL Database or Azure Synapse Analytics – This eliminates the need to . The max length of the intermittent external table in polybase (behind the scenes, PolyBase creates an External Table) is nvarchar (4000).
Introducing data virtualization with PolyBase
Contenu connexe.PolyBase allows processing data using native SQL queries from the external data sources.
This is a simple 3-columned text file. Use the staging blob feature to achieve high load speeds from all types of data stores, including Azure Blob storage and Data Lake Store.Recommended for loading data or data exploration. Using it, you can load the data into a dedicated SQL pool table in parallel.
Tutorial: Load data using Azure portal & SSMS
Critiques : 62 Además, PolyBase permite a Azure Synapse Analytics importar y exportar datos desde Azure Data Lake Store y Azure Blob Storage.
Loading data with PolyBase in Azure SQL Data Warehouse
Data loading best practices for dedicated SQL pools
Test result: Command .
This is the most scalable and fastest way. Using it, you can load the .
PolyBase query scenarios
To accomplish this task, follow the same steps listed previously.SQL Data Warehouse DWU can be scaled either up and down in a matter of minutes. To find the value for providers, see PolyBase Connectivity Configuration.To learn more about PolyBase and designing an Extract, Load, and Transform (ELT) process, see Design ELT for Azure Synapse Analytics.
Reload to refresh your session.
Why Azure Data Factory when we have Polybase
Make sure the database scoped credential, server address, port, and location string correlate to that of the Azure SQL Database data source you want to connect to.In Part 3 we will review Integration tools which make use of Polybase to load data (ADF/Databricks) In Part 4 we will review how to modify your existing Polybase configuration without recreation.Learn about Polybase, a feature in SQL Server 2016 that can help improve data loading processes. 17 contributeurs.PolyBase を使用してデータを読み込むためのオプション. If you do not have it installed, run the . By: Brad Harris. If you have huge volumes and are maxing the storage, then use multiple storage accounts to spread the load. Diese externen Daten .
Virtualisation des données avec PolyBase dans SQL Server
This table lists the key features for PolyBase and the products in which they're available.Get help at Microsoft Q&A. Limitations connues. S’applique à : SQL .x) This article explains how to use PolyBase to query external data in S3-compatible object storage.
Manquant :
data loadingData Virtualization with PolyBase for SQL Server 2022
Today, we are going to talk about how to load data from Azure Blob Storage into Azure SQL data warehouse using PolyBase.Con la ayuda de PolyBase, las consultas T-SQL también pueden importar y exportar datos desde Azure Blob Storage.When exporting data to Hadoop or Azure Blob Storage via PolyBase, only the data is exported, not the column names (metadata) as defined in the CREATE EXTERNAL TABLE command.Polybase supports fast data loading using the bulk insert feature, which allows it to load large volumes of data quickly and efficiently.Incremental Loads in Polybase.Polybase is a technology that accesses external data stored in Azure Blob storage, Hadoop, or Azure Data Lake store using the Transact-SQL language.You signed in with another tab or window.Using PolyBase to Load Data to a Dedicated SQL Pool Table. PolyBase allows you to read/write data in external storage using T-SQL. Download Microsoft Edge More info . Part of Microsoft Azure Collective. JRE is used by SQL Server to connect to Poly Base.
PolyBase in SQL Server: 1 Powerful Tool
When you are creating an external table with PolyBase, the column definitions, including the data types and .
This technology was introduced by Microsoft in 2012 to allow a relational database such as Parallel Data Warehouse (MPP) to talk to files stored on Hadoop’s Distributed File System (HDFS). Viewed 745 times. This article will help you understand the process to ingest .Loading data from Azure Blob configured with VNet service endpoint, either as the original source or as staging store, in which case underneath ADF automatically switch to abfss:// scheme to create external data source as required by PolyBase. Possible Solution: Create the external table first and then use INSERT INTO SELECT to export to the external location. In this lab, we'll create various PolyBase components to load the data from a data lake file to a table in the dedicated SQL pool. PolyBase enables your SQL Server instance to query data with T-SQL directly from SQL Server, . PolyBase is a database scoped . Applies to: SQL Server 2022 (16.Install PolyBase on Windows or install PolyBase on Linux. During installation, specify the location of the Java Runtime Environment (JRE). PolyBase を使用してデータを読み込むには、次のいずれかの読み込みオプションを使用します。 T-SQL を使用した PolyBase - データが Azure Blob Storage または Azure Data Lake Store 内にある場合に最適です .x) introduces the ability to connect to any S3-compatible object storage, there are two available options for authentication: basic authentication or pass-through authorization . Enable PolyBase in sp_configure if necessary. Do this from within Azure where the . Therefore, if the max length of the source column is greater than nvarchar (4000), polybase option can’t be . I have also created a local system DSN (from ODBC32 .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support.Unparalleled performance by using PolyBase: Polybase is the most efficient way to move data into Azure Synapse Analytics. Introduction: In this article I will discuss how to monitor and debug a PolyBase Load in Azure Synapse Analytics using system views and custom views (user . In Part 1 we will focus on the most sought-after feature within Polybase, Connecting to a Secured storage . For a loading . Installing PolyBase is made possible by this option.To ingest the data from supported repositories into dedicated SQL pools, PolyBase is as efficient and at times it’s even more efficient than the COPY command. Modified 5 years, 2 months ago.Category Performance tuning tips; Data store specific: Loading data into Azure Synapse Analytics: suggest using PolyBase or COPY statement if it's not used.This article describes the mapping between PolyBase external data sources and SQL Server.PolyBase allows you to read/write data in external storage using T-SQL. Dans cet article.The two options labeled “Polybase” and the “COPY command” are only applicable to Azure Synapse Analytics (formerly Azure SQL Data Warehouse).First, configure SQL Server PolyBase to use Azure Blob Storage.
Using Polybase loading data from DataBricks to Azure DW with
This tutorial uses PolyBase to load the WideWorldImportersDW data warehouse from Azure Blob storage to your data warehouse in Azure Synapse Analytics SQL pool.
Access external data: Azure Blob Storage
SQL Server Oracle MongoDB Hadoop Azure Blob Storage Teradata ODBC Generic Types In this article, we use SQL Server 2019 for configuring the PolyBase feature.PolyBase ermöglicht T-SQL-Abfragen, Daten aus externen Quellen mit relationalen Tabellen in einer Instanz von SQL Server zu verknüpfen. This browser is no longer supported.In this article. Synthèse des fonctionnalités pour les versions du produit. For a code sample, see .
Each reader automatically read 512MB for each file for Azure Storage BLOB and 256MB on Azure Data Lake Storage. It can retrieve data from SQL relational database, NoSQL, ODBC and Bigdata as well. They are both fast methods of loading which involve staging data in Azure storage (if it’s not already in Azure Storage) and using a fast, highly parallel method of loading to each compute . If you are exporting from SQL Server, you can use bcp command-line tool to export the data into delimited text files. I have created an EXTERNAL TABLE for PolyBase to load data from BLOB storage to Azure SQL Data Warehouse.1: PolyBase automatically parallelizes the data load process, so you don’t need to explicitly break the input data into multiple files and issue concurrent loads, unlike some traditional loading practices.PolyBase permet aux requêtes T-SQL de joindre les données de sources externes à des tables relationnelles dans une instance de SQL Server. You signed out in another tab or window. Polybase and Copy Command are two most prominent methods for performing high throughput loads from Azure Storage to Azure Synapse. (Polybase supports Azure Blob storage and Azure Data Lake Store by default. It is available from SQL Server 2016 onwards.
Manquant :
data loadingFirst test, loading the DataBricks DataFrame to Azure SQL DW directly without using PolyBase and Blob Storage, simply via JDBC connection. In case you are .PolyBase Introduction
Microsoft Fabric Learn Together.Polybase does require data being in Azure Storage, I will be addressing the most common pattern where files are loaded from Azure Storage to Azure Synapse .